Alice Laverne McVay, 68, of Haileyville, died Sunday, Feb. 1, 2009, at her home in Haileyville. Born Aug. 19, 1940, in McAlester, to William Elbert and Edith Lucy (Short) Pike, she enjoyed camping and fishing and was of the Pentecostal faith. Survivors include two sons, William David McVay, of Haileyville, Wade Eugene McVay, of Haileyville; grandchildren, Alisha and David Williamson, Jason McVay, Chad and Cassie Lightle; nine great-grandchildren; mother, Edith Lucy Pike, of Haileyville, and three sisters, Fay Loretta Voelker, of Haileyville, Adele Louise Stamps, of Krebs, Sarah Jean Munoz, of McAlester. She was preceded in death by her father, William Elbert Pike and one sister, Iona Thomason. Graveside services will be at 2 p.m. Thursday at Dorsey Cemetery on the north side of Lake McAlester with Pastor Kenneth Clay officiating. Burial will be at Dorsey Cemetery under the direction of Brumley-Mills Funeral Home of Hartshorne.
